# Quotas and limits in Application Load Balancer

Application Load Balancer has the following limits:

* [_Quotas_](https://console.yandex.cloud/cloud?section=quotas) are organizational constraints that can be changed by contacting technical support.
* _Limits_ are technical constraints of the Yandex Cloud architecture. You cannot change the limits.

If you need more resources, you can increase your quotas in one of the following ways:

* [Make a request to increase your quotas](https://console.yandex.cloud/cloud?section=quotas).
* Contact [support](https://center.yandex.cloud/support) and specify which quotas you want increased and by how much.

To have your request processed, you must have the `quota-manager.requestOperator` [role](../../iam/roles-reference.md#quota-manager-requestoperator) or higher, e.g., `editor` or `admin`.

You can manage your quotas with [Cloud Quota Manager](../../quota-manager/quickstart.md).

#### Quotas {#quotas}

#|
|| Type of limitation | Value ||
|| Maximum number of load balancers per cloud
`apploadbalancer.loadBalancers.count` | 4 ||
|| Maximum number of HTTP routers per cloud
`apploadbalancer.httpRouters.count` | 16 ||
|| Maximum number of backend groups per cloud
`apploadbalancer.backendGroups.count` | 32 ||
|| Maximum number of target groups per cloud
`apploadbalancer.targetGroups.count` | 32 ||
|#

#### Limits {#limits}

Type of limit | Value
----- | -----
Maximum number of resources per target group | 256
Maximum number of backends per backend group | 8
Maximum number of virtual hosts per HTTP router | 64
Maximum number of routes per HTTP router | 128
Maximum number of listeners per L7 load balancer | 8
Maximum number of SNI listeners per L7 load balancer | 32
Maximum number of authority headers you can specify for a virtual host | 32
